16 hours ago, now said:

Just curious, are you pegging certain lower prospects as future top #15, or just playing law of averages?

My post was about the law of averages. That said, there are a few guys I like a lot to move up. DeLeon is the big guy to watch from below 15 in Tony's power rankings from what I understand. Just going by what I hear, I could imagine Tony giving him a big bump in his offseason list. I really look forward to what he writes because it's hard for fans like me to distinguish between hype and reality.

Just looking at his list, the problem I have is many of the ones I like are either really young or new to the org, so they have a ton to prove. That's the law of averages part. A couple will likely be top 15 guys. DeLeon and Baumler (who I hate to give up on) are my two personal favorites who seem to have the upside to be top 10 guys if they have healthy years.

Here are my personal favorites after 15.

17 Braylin Tavera CF 17   FCL O's  
19 Jackson Baumeister  RHP 19   FCL O's  
20 Luis DeLeon LHP 20   DEL (A)  
21 Keifer Lord RHP 21   FCL O's  
22 Luis Almeyda CF 22   DSL O's  
23 Trace Bright RHP 23   ABN (A+)  
29 Carter Baumler RHP 29   DEL (A)
